Checking the day's mandi numbers for 04 Aug 2026, Neemuch APMC stood at the front of the pack for Nigella Seeds, clocking the day's best rate at ₹19,201 per quintal. No other reporting yard came in higher, which is why this mandi is worth a closer look today.

03How Other Mandis Compare Today
The table below lines up Nigella Seeds rates across the markets that reported on 04 Aug 2026, so you can see where Neemuch APMC sits versus the rest. A clear front-runner tends to shape what nearby yards quote.
| Mandi | Price (₹ / quintal) |
|---|---|
| 1 Neemuch APMC Leader | ₹19,201 |
| 2 Mandsaur APMC | ₹17,435 |
04The Spread: Best vs Cheapest Yard
The gap between the day's dearest and cheapest market shows how wide the buying opportunity is — and whether it's worth carting produce further out.
That ₹1,766 (10.1%) difference is the day's opportunity: the same Nigella Seeds fetched noticeably more at the top yard than at the softest one.
052-Week Price Trend at a Glance
Over the last two weeks, Nigella Seeds prices at Neemuch APMC ranged between ₹14,800 and ₹19,781, with the average around ₹18,396. A rate sitting near the top of this range points to firm demand, while a move toward the lower band suggests easing pressure.
